Sing Out is a summer workshop experience for rising 4th, 5th, and 6th grade students as well as music educators, who are interested in learning more about singing and choreography. We are bringing together nationally-known clinicians to work with participants in rehearsals as well as present special interest sessions. We hope to enhance and promote quality rehearsal and performance skills as well as expose participants to a wide variety of music and choral related topics.
